Developer Solutions Consultant

About the job

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ience.
  • 5 years of experience in either system design or in one programming language (e.g., Java, C++, Python, etc.).
  • 5 years of experience in technical troubleshooting, and managing internal/external partners or customers.

Preferred qualifications:

  • Experience in technical consulting or technical project management in environments.
  • Experience in Android development.
  • Experience with Java or Kotlin.
  • Experience with Google Cloud integration.
  • Excellent communication and project management skills.

Responsibilities

  • Develop an understanding of Google Play’s products/solutions and underlying architectures. Create workflows, processes, and tools to meet the Play program requirements.
  • Manage operational performance of third-party vendor operations to ensure Play is able to deliver high quality technical enforcement and appeals processes.
  • Work with developers to drive adherence and adoption of high quality Play features and services.
  • Develop advanced product knowledge with specialization in one or more components, including dependencies on other products and teams.
  • Work with external developers, generate developer insights and create written guidance and Act as consultant and subject matter expert for internal stakeholders in engineering, partnership, developer organisations to improve Plays products, tools and services.
